Adaption of #8356 Summary Data : Add support for use of summary summary data from Python

This commit is contained in:
Magne Sjaastad
2022-03-26 16:57:46 +01:00
parent a08014e018
commit 7c4e81f59f
14 changed files with 810 additions and 7 deletions

View File

@@ -92,3 +92,24 @@ private:
caf::PdmField<QString> m_addressString;
caf::PdmField<QString> m_resamplingPeriod;
};
//==================================================================================================
///
//==================================================================================================
class RimSummaryCase_setSummaryVectorValues : public caf::PdmObjectMethod
{
CAF_PDM_HEADER_INIT;
public:
RimSummaryCase_setSummaryVectorValues( caf::PdmObjectHandle* self );
caf::PdmObjectHandle* execute() override;
bool resultIsPersistent() const override;
std::unique_ptr<PdmObjectHandle> defaultResult() const override;
bool isNullptrValidResult() const override;
private:
caf::PdmField<QString> m_addressString;
caf::PdmField<QString> m_unitString;
caf::PdmField<std::vector<float>> m_values;
};